Unlocking The Potential Of Compressed Natural Gas (CNG) In Nigeria: A Technical And Market Analysis

This study provides a comprehensive analysis of the potential of Compressed Natural Gas (CNG) as a viable energy alternative in Nigeria, focusing on its technical and market feasibility. Nigeria, with substantial natural gas reserves, has yet to fully exploit CNG for transportation and cooking due to infrastructure limitations, high conversion costs, and low public awareness. The analysis compares the advantages of CNG over other fuels, such as Liquefied Petroleum Gas (LPG) and diesel, highlighting its higher combustion efficiency, lower emissions, and suitability for high-compression engines. The study identifies key challenges, including infrastructure deficits and safety concerns, and proposes solutions to mitigate these barriers. The potential market for CNG in transportation and cooking sectors in Nigeria is vast, with significant cost savings and environmental benefits. Strategic initiatives, including government incentives, public awareness campaigns, and infrastructure development, are critical to unlocking the potential of CNG, positioning it as a cornerstone of sustainable energy future in Nigeria.
